Yeah, there's a reason it's Oklahoma. The Indian Removal Act of 1830 essentially forced the vast majority of tribes east of the Mississippi to move west of it. A lot of tribes wound up in eastern Oklahoma and Kansas. Most of the focus of that act was on the five "civilized" tribes who were in Southern states, but it happened everywhere. Some tribes just went more easily than others.
